general-medical-council-logo.pngGetting an Adult ADHD Diagnosis

Receiving an ADHD diagnosis as an adult is not easy. This is due in part to the fact that a lot of medical staff members have preconceived beliefs about what ADHD appears and feels like for adults.

The first step is to contact the clinic for an assessment. You will be provided with a screening questionnaire that you must fill out (and have an adult in your family sign). The results are then interpreted by the clinician.

The process

Adults with ADHD might have trouble identifying their condition. Even if those with ADHD are aware of their condition it might be difficult for them to admit to their doctor. It is crucial to receive an accurate diagnosis as quickly as you can. In the event that symptoms are not addressed, they could create serious problems for them both in their professional and personal life.

A private adult ADHD assessment involves an in-depth interview and assessment by a qualified psychiatrist or psychologist. The evaluation will consist of an overall questionnaire as well as questions about how much does private adhd assessment cost the symptoms affect different aspects of their life. The psychiatrist will inquire with the client about any other mental health issues they may have. This will help them determine if ADHD is the right diagnosis.

The questionnaires can be completed ahead of time and are typically posted on the website of the company conducting the assessment. The psychiatrist will review these questions before meeting with the patient to conduct the assessment. It is also crucial that the person paying for the assessment brings a proof of identification on the day of the appointment. It is crucial for the psychiatrist to know who they are attending to, so it is helpful to bring along the names of those you're meeting.

Most private adult adhd assessment uk assessment companies will require a GP referral letter prior to scheduling an appointment. The GP could write the letter prior to the appointment or they can be asked by the service to complete the letter on the day of the assessment. The GP will be able to explain to the psychiatrist why it is necessary to evaluate the client.

After the assessment is completed, the clinician will discuss treatment options with the client. This could be medication, or cognitive behavioral therapy. If the therapist believes that the client is in compliance with ADHD criteria they will determine the cause and refer them to their GP.

It is important to note that some NHS services in England have lengthy waiting times. Those who are willing to pay for their examination privately can avoid this by utilizing the service via the 'Right to Choose process. This will allow them bypass the NHS waiting list and receive their assessment more quickly.

Making an accurate diagnosis

Getting an ADHD diagnosis can be a life-changing moment. After years of feeling guilty or embarrassed about their issues many people are given a diagnosis to realise they aren't the only one. It may take some time to process the grief that often accompanies the diagnosis, but it is possible to learn how to manage your symptoms and make good choices. ADHD symptoms can be managed with treatment, medication or lifestyle changes.

A clinical meeting with a psychologist, psychiatrist or nurse is required for an ADHD assessment. The assessment will include a discussion of your symptoms along with a medical history as well as a screening questionnaire. It could also include an interview with a clinician using the Diagnostic Interview for ADHD Adults or other tools for children who are younger than 18 years old.

The assessment can be conducted either in person or online and usually takes two hours. Patients are encouraged to discuss their symptoms openly and honestly without fear of judgement. It is essential for the person who is being assessed to discuss their symptoms in detail and to describe how they impact their daily life as well as relationships and overall well-being. It is also essential for the assessor to be aware of the impact that unmanaged ADHD can have on the individual's functioning.

Treatment options

ADHD is an illness that affects people differently. It can make it difficult to manage everyday tasks which can lead to issues with organisation and completing projects. It can also lead to emotional stress, which could have a negative impact on relationships and work performance. It's important for adults with ADHD to seek treatment to improve their lives. There are many treatment options.

One of the most popular treatment options for adults with ADHD is medication. There are also other options for treatment, such as cognitive behavioral therapy and psychological counseling. It is also a good idea to locate a psychiatrist who specialises in adult ADHD. This will ensure that your doctor is informed of the most recent research and is well-versed in treating adults with ADHD.

Adult ADHD medications are usually taken orally and may be prescribed to you by your psychiatrist. It is possible to start on a low dosage and gradually increased, a process called titration. The psychiatrist will be able to monitor your progress and inform you about the potential side effects of the medication prior to making any modifications. You should also visit your GP regularly for check-ups to see how the medication is working.

Follow-up

ADHD symptoms can lead to difficulties in many areas. Adults with ADHD might have difficulty keeping commitments to their relationships or work as well as experience financial challenges and lack of success in school or training. They may be unhappy or dissatisfied with their lives and are dissatisfied by the quality of their relationships. They may also have an antecedent of substance abuse and addiction, often to alcohol and drugs. They may feel anxiety, depression, or anger and agitation.

The evaluation of ADHD is a detailed medical evaluation led by a consultant psychiatrist who will review the results of any questionnaires completed, take a full medical and family history, and conduct a detailed interview with you. The appointment typically lasts two hours, and will include talking about a variety of subjects, including your symptoms, how they affect you and what else has transpired in your life, and whether any other mental health issues are present.

You will receive a consultation report via email within four weeks after the assessment. It will include a medical diagnosis, accommodations for work/school/home, non-medication and medication management recommendations. It is recommended to share the information with your GP to ensure that they can help you with any ongoing treatment. If medication is prescribed by a private adhd assessments doctor it is not through the NHS. Once you are stable with your treatment, your psychiatrist can ask your doctor to take over the prescription.
